Quick summary
Snail Driver is a utility that searches a PC for outdated or missing device drivers and can automatically download and install the appropriate packages. After each scan it provides a report listing the detected hardware, the driver versions currently installed, and whether newer drivers are recommended.
How it works
The program performs a system scan, identifies each component and its driver status, then offers updates that can be applied automatically. The goal is to reduce manual searching and installation of driver files by handling downloads and setup steps for the user.
Ideal users
This tool is aimed primarily at less technical or novice computer owners who may find it difficult to track down component-specific drivers. By automating detection and installation, it helps save both time and effort compared with locating drivers manually.
